The “ugly” illustration in the textbook is from Wu Yong’s studio. The design studio has no industrial and commercial registration information: Are netizens questioning their feelings?

Netizens are still discussing whether the cartoon illustrations in the PPE version of elementary school math textbooks are “ugly”. On May 26, some netizens found the title page of this edition of the textbook, pointing out that “Beijing Wu Yong Design Studio” was responsible for the creation of illustrations for the textbook.

According to the data, Wu Yong graduated from the Central Academy of Arts and Crafts (now the Academy of Fine Arts of Tsinghua University), majoring in book binding. He is a designer and the founder of Beijing Wu Yong Design Studio. He used to be the director, professor and master tutor of Visual Communication Department of Changjiang Institute of Art and Design, Shantou University.

Recently, the illustrations of the PPE version of mathematics textbooks have attracted public attention. Some netizens said that the illustration characters have strange eyes and no aesthetic sense, and there is a clear aesthetic gap compared with other versions of textbook illustrations. The supplementary page of the textbook shows that the illustrations (including the cover) were designed by Beijing Wu Yong Design Studio.

Tianyancha searched for relevant keywords such as “Beijing Wu Yong Design Studio”, but failed to find the industrial and commercial registration information of related companies. At present, in response to the incident, the People’s Education Publishing House responded that it would redraw the controversial illustrations and cover.

In May 2022, the illustrations of the PPE version of mathematics textbooks provided by Beijing Wu Yong Design Studio caused controversy. For this hot search,Some netizens directly posted that some people discovered the problem in 2014, but it was not until 2022 that it attracted the attention of netizens and was ready to change. In 2018, #wuyong# was interviewed by the industry self-media “Zhankuwang” WeChat public account. In this interview article titled “Wu Yong: Book Design is a Kind of Feeling”, Wu Yong said about his concept of engaging in book design: the change from “good-looking” to “good reading” is actually a difference in design vision and pattern make it happen. This kind of change has abandoned the narrow view of binding that is only “book clothing” and “overall design”.

By sorting out the order of information and transforming the design into a pleasant and functional visual guide, we try to give readers more diverse reading enjoyment and thinking space. With the help of form, editing, materials, information, craftsmanship, cost design, and even materialized “five senses” experiential design, it strives to mobilize readers’ “full senses” to enjoy, thus forming a scene-based reading setup and realizing readers’ subconscious psychological demands , and then resonate with the book itself.

In the above-mentioned interview with the industry’s self-media, the controversial illustrations of the “Personal Education Textbook for Primary School Compulsory Education Mathematics” were also presented as Wu Yong’s classic works.
